Key Features & Highlights
- Digital Imaging and 3D Scanning: Gone are the days of uncomfortable and imprecise traditional X-rays. Modern clinics use digital imaging and 3D scanning technologies to create highly detailed images of teeth and gums. These images allow dentists to diagnose issues with greater accuracy and plan treatments more effectively, reducing the need for invasive procedures.
- Laser Dentistry: Laser technology has revolutionized many dental procedures, including cavity detection, gum reshaping, and teeth whitening. Lasers are less invasive than traditional tools, minimize pain and bleeding, and promote faster healing. Patients benefit from quicker recovery times and reduced discomfort during procedures.
- Invisalign and Clear Aligners: For those seeking to straighten their teeth without the hassle of metal braces, Invisalign and other clear aligners offer a discreet and comfortable solution. These aligners are custom-made using advanced imaging technology and are virtually invisible, making them a popular choice among adults and teens alike.
- Teledentistry: The rise of telemedicine has extended to dentistry, allowing patients to consult with dentists remotely through video calls and digital platforms. Teledentistry is particularly beneficial for routine check-ups, follow-ups, and minor issues, reducing the need for in-person visits and making dental care more accessible.
- AI-Powered Diagnostics: Artificial intelligence is making waves in dental diagnostics by analyzing patient data to identify potential issues such as cavities, gum disease, or oral cancer. AI algorithms can process vast amounts of information quickly, helping dentists make more accurate and timely diagnoses, leading to early intervention and better treatment outcomes.
- Biocompatible Materials: Modern dental clinics prioritize the use of biocompatible materials for fillings, crowns, and implants. These materials are not only durable and long-lasting but also safer for patients, reducing the risk of allergic reactions or adverse side effects. Innovations in materials science have led to the development of tooth-colored fillings and ceramic crowns that blend seamlessly with natural teeth.

How do digital X-rays compare to traditional X-rays?
Digital X-rays provide several advantages over traditional X-rays. They emit up to 90% less radiation, making them safer for patients. The images are produced instantly and can be easily shared with specialists or stored digitally for future reference. Digital X-rays also offer superior image quality, allowing dentists to detect issues like cavities or bone loss with greater precision. Furthermore, they eliminate the need for chemical processing, reducing environmental impact and waste.
Are laser dental treatments safe?
Yes, laser dental treatments are considered safe when performed by trained and experienced professionals. Lasers have been approved by regulatory bodies such as the FDA for various dental procedures, including gum reshaping and cavity treatment. They are precise and minimize damage to surrounding tissues, reducing pain and swelling. However, it is essential to consult with a qualified dentist to determine if laser treatment is suitable for your specific dental needs.
What is teledentistry, and how can it benefit me?
Teledentistry is a branch of telemedicine that enables patients to receive dental care remotely through digital platforms. It is particularly useful for routine consultations, follow-up appointments, and minor dental issues. Teledentistry saves time and reduces the need for travel, making dental care more convenient and accessible. It is also beneficial for patients in rural or underserved areas who may have limited access to dental professionals. While teledentistry cannot replace in-person visits for all procedures, it serves as a valuable tool for maintaining oral health and seeking timely advice.
What are the drawbacks of clear aligners like Invisalign?
While clear aligners offer many advantages, they also have some limitations. One of the main drawbacks is that they require a high level of patient compliance. Aligners must be worn for at least 20-22 hours a day to be effective, and failure to do so can prolong treatment time or reduce effectiveness. Additionally, clear aligners may not be suitable for complex orthodontic cases that require significant tooth movement. They can also be more expensive than traditional braces, depending on the treatment plan. Lastly, maintaining oral hygiene with aligners requires diligence, as food particles can get trapped between the aligners and teeth if not cleaned properly.
